Dlaczego wymagany jest nagłówek żądania hosta?
Dlaczego wymagany jest nagłówek żądania hosta?

Wideo: Dlaczego wymagany jest nagłówek żądania hosta?

Wideo: Dlaczego wymagany jest nagłówek żądania hosta?
Wideo: Parts of an HTTP Request 2024, Listopad
Anonim

HTTP 1.1 upraszanie często zawierają Gospodarz : nagłówek , który zawiera nazwę hosta od klienta wniosek . Dzieje się tak, ponieważ serwer może akceptować pojedynczy adres IP lub interfejs upraszanie dla wielu nazw hostów DNS. ten Gospodarz : nagłówek identyfikuje serwer wymagany przez klienta.

Co więcej, czym jest host w nagłówku żądania?

ten Nagłówek żądania hosta określa nazwę domeny serwera (dla virtual hosting ) i (opcjonalnie) numer portu TCP, na którym nasłuchuje serwer. A Nagłówek hosta pole musi być wysłane we wszystkich HTTP/1.1 wniosek wiadomości.

Wiesz również, dlaczego istnieje potrzeba uwzględniania hosta w komunikatach żądań GET i HEAD HTTP 1.1? ten Hostuj nagłówek jest obowiązkowy, ponieważ HTTP / 1.1 oraz jego używany do hostingu wirtualnego. Ono musi włączać nazwę domeny serwera i numer portu TCP, na którym serwer nasłuchuje. Numer portu można pominąć, jeśli port jest standardowym portem dla żądanej usługi (80 dla HTTP i 443 dla

Czym w ten sposób jest nagłówek w żądaniu?

HTTP nagłówek żądania to informacja w formie rekordu tekstowego, którą przeglądarka użytkownika wysyła do serwera sieci Web, zawierająca szczegóły tego, czego przeglądarka chce i co zaakceptuje z powrotem z serwera.

Czy nagłówek hosta jest obowiązkowy?

Jeśli nie ma Nagłówek hosta pole, możesz nie uzyskać wyników, na które liczyłeś, jeśli serwer docelowy jest serwerem wirtualnym gospodarz który nie ma własnego adresu IP, aby odróżnić się od innych wirtualnych zastępy niebieskie . HTTP 1.1 wymaga Gospodarz pole. Żaden z Nagłówki są wymagany we wniosku.

Zalecana: